With regards to the MIgration assistant, is it a long process?

Does it pull over all the programs ( like Ilife, Iwork, and things I have installed)

A wise choice on your part. I'm down to one PC in the house, and that's only because work won't support a Mac-based VPN client. :(

As for Migration Assistant, it depends on the amount of data you need moved over. If you've never used it, it's sweet. It will migrate not only your data, but all of you account information and settings, even for things like your mail accounts, keychains, etc.
